Flash function helps to perform the pT flash calculation for alkanes
assuming ideal gas and liquid behaviour.
[a,x,y] = flash(comp,z,p,T)
a = mole fraction of vapour.
x = mole fraction in liquid
y = mole fraction in vapour
z = mole fraction in mixture (make sure that sum(z) = 1)
comp = Cells of strings of the name of the constituents of the gas
p = pressure
T = Temperature
Example.
If we have a mixture of methane, ethane and propane, with mole fractions of
0.3,0.4,0.2 in a mixture and we want to obtain a flash result at T 200k,
pressure of 20bars
We simply define
p = 20;
T = 200;
z = [0.3,0.4,0.2];
comp = {{'methane'},{'ethane'},{'propane'}};
and then call
[a,x,y] = flash(comp,z,p,T)
